we have a lot of marc here wich are less actives and recent converts. and while i was planing for teaching them this is what i found:
that the first step is faith- you need to have faith in jesus christ, the atonement god, prophets, all that... and you need to hear the lessons for wich to base your faith upon
second is concrete faith or knowledge- this step is where you test your faith. for example we are the only church that i know of that if you put your time to learn about the teachings of Christ through the bible, book of mormon, other lituraters ect. and then ask god, the same god we all believe in if it is true.. you can reacieve a spiritual witness that it it the truth. this is when your faith becomes knowledge
third is repentance- this is a step of action where we if we want are able to repent of our sins
fourth- baptism- this is where you make a covenant that you will always remember and follow Jesus Christ
fifth enduring to the end- this is the most important step because a lot of people. in costa rica esspecially believe that believing is enough. that getting baptized is enough. but as we learn through the bible that we need to follow Jesus Christ. siempre (always). we are not entitled to glory. we are however entitled to the opportunity to recieve glory. this is what most people don't understand. faith without works is dead. blessings are promised to us but only after we do all we can do.
